Bonfire Night, also known as Guy Fawkes Night, is an annual traditional festival held in the United Kingdom on November 5th. This festival commemorates the historic event of thwarting a plot to blow up the British Parliament in 1605, for which Guy Fawkes was arrested after hiding explosives. On this day, Britons create bonfires filled with flames and enjoy fireworks displays to commemorate the occasion. Bonfire Night is an opportunity for people to gather with friends and family, enjoy the fire, and revel in fireworks and sparklers.
